책 내용 질문하기
엑셀 기본모의고사 2회 문제 2의 2번 질문드려요
도서
2018 시나공 컴퓨터활용능력 1급 실기(엑셀, 액세스 2010 사용자용)
페이지
321
조회수
44
작성일
2018-05-09
작성자
탈퇴*원
첨부파일

단가 구하는 문제에서 답은

=HLOOKUP(C13,$B$2:$G$3,2,FALSE)*IF(D13<=100,1.1,1)

이었고,

제가 작성한 오답은

=IF($D13<=100,HLOOKUP($C13,$B$2:$G$3,2,FALSE)+10%,HLOOKUP($C13,$B$2:$G$3,2,FALSE))

였습니다.

답이 이해가 안되는건 아닌데, 제가 작성한 오답이 왜 오답이 되는지가 이해가 잘 되지 않아서 질문남깁니다.

보니까 조건에 만족하지 않은 경우(단가)는 맞게 나오는데,

조건에 만족한 경우(단가+단가의 10%)가 다르게 나오더라구요.

HLOOKUP($C13,$B$2:$G$3,2,FALSE)+10%는 단가+단가의10%가 될 수 없는건가요?

답변
2018-05-14 23:17:45

주어진 함수를 사용하여 정확한 결과가 나온다면 식이 달라도 정답으로 인정 됩니다.

단가는 상품에 따라 다르다고 했으므로 hlookup으로 찾아서 표시 하구요.

수량이 100이하일 경우에는 단가에 단가의 10%를 더하여 계산 하라고 했습니다.

원래 단가가 50 이라면 여기에 10% 를 더하면 55가 되죠?

즉 원래단가 50(100%) 에 5(10%) 를 더한다~ 이므로

110% 가 됩니다.

즉 원래 단가에 110% 를 곱해야 하죠.

110% 는 1.1 로 사용 할 수 있습니다.

조건에 맞지 않으면 그냥 단가를 표시 해야되죠?

원래단가 50 에 * 1 을 하면 그냥 50이므로

원래 단가를 표시 할 수 있습니다.

그래서 1.1 과 1 을 사용 한 것입니다.

110% 와 100% 로 사용 하셔도 됩니다.

=IF($D13<=100,HLOOKUP($C13,$B$2:$G$3,2,FALSE)+10%,HLOOKUP($C13,$B$2:$G$3,2,FALSE))

=IF($D13<=100,HLOOKUP($C13,$B$2:$G$3,2,FALSE)*110%,HLOOKUP($C13,$B$2:$G$3,2,FALSE))

+10% 가 아니라 *110% 혹은 *1.1 로 지정해 보세요.

좋은 하루 되세요.

  • *
    2018-05-14 23:17:45

    주어진 함수를 사용하여 정확한 결과가 나온다면 식이 달라도 정답으로 인정 됩니다.

    단가는 상품에 따라 다르다고 했으므로 hlookup으로 찾아서 표시 하구요.

    수량이 100이하일 경우에는 단가에 단가의 10%를 더하여 계산 하라고 했습니다.

    원래 단가가 50 이라면 여기에 10% 를 더하면 55가 되죠?

    즉 원래단가 50(100%) 에 5(10%) 를 더한다~ 이므로

    110% 가 됩니다.

    즉 원래 단가에 110% 를 곱해야 하죠.

    110% 는 1.1 로 사용 할 수 있습니다.

    조건에 맞지 않으면 그냥 단가를 표시 해야되죠?

    원래단가 50 에 * 1 을 하면 그냥 50이므로

    원래 단가를 표시 할 수 있습니다.

    그래서 1.1 과 1 을 사용 한 것입니다.

    110% 와 100% 로 사용 하셔도 됩니다.

    =IF($D13<=100,HLOOKUP($C13,$B$2:$G$3,2,FALSE)+10%,HLOOKUP($C13,$B$2:$G$3,2,FALSE))

    =IF($D13<=100,HLOOKUP($C13,$B$2:$G$3,2,FALSE)*110%,HLOOKUP($C13,$B$2:$G$3,2,FALSE))

    +10% 가 아니라 *110% 혹은 *1.1 로 지정해 보세요.

    좋은 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.